Decoding Dictionary 

Understanding the important elements of a dictionary



An English language skill seeker would never afford to ignore the importance of a dictionary. It is the most powerful tool in the way of learning English or any other language. The process of consulting dictionary is much deeper than what we do. It is not limited to see the desired meaning of the word, but it needs to be studied scientifically. Most of us even don’t know the core elements of a dictionary and hence, we can’t properly go through it. In this article, we are trying to learn the core aspects of a dictionary which we should be acquainted with. 



Headword

Headwords are written on the top of the entry alphabetically. They are a reference point for the information about any word. 


Pronunciation 

Phonetic symbols or a pronunciation key that helps users correctly pronounce the word. This feature aids in achieving accurate spoken communication.


Part of Speech

An indication of the grammatical category to which the word belongs (e.g., noun, verb, adjective, adverb). It helps users understand the word’s syntactic role in sentences.


Guide words

They serve as a reference point to help users quickly locate the word they are looking for within the dictionary. Typically, there are two guide words on each page or column.


Definition

Clear and concise explanations of the word’s meanings. Multiple definitions are provided if the word has multiple senses or uses.


Usage Examples

Sentences or phrases that demonstrate how the word is used in context. Usage examples help users understand the word’s practical application.


Etymology

Information about the word’s origin, history, and linguistic roots. Etymology provides insights into the word’s development over time and its connections to other languages.


Abbreviations and Symbols

Explanation of abbreviations and symbols used in the dictionary, such as part-of-speech abbreviations, pronunciation symbols, and usage markers.


List of common abbreviation used in a dictionary

1. adj. : adjective

2. adv. : adverb

3. n. : noun

4. v. : verb

5. prep. : preposition

6. pron. : pronoun

7. conj. : conjunction

8. interj.: interjection

9. pl. : plural

10. sing. : singular

11. abbr. : abbreviation

12. def. : definition

13. syn. : synonym

14. ant. : antonym

15. cf. : compare 

16. e.g. : for example 

17. etc. : et cetera 

18. i.e. : that is 

19. cf. : confer

20. lit. : literally 

21. fig. : figuratively 

22. orig. : originally

23. pronun.: pronunciation

24. ETY : etymology 

25. abbr.: abbreviation 

26. usu. : usually 

27. comp.: comparative 

28. superl.: superlative 

29. phr. : phrase

30. ex. : example

31. var. : variant 

32. obsolete: no longer in use

33. archaic: old-fashioned 

34. dialect.: dialectal 

35. Skt. : Sanskrit 

36. Fr. : French 

37. L. : Latin
